Answers to Prayer - George Muller

1. Get my heart into such a state that it has no will of its own in regard to a given matter.
2. Do not trust in feelings.
3. Seek the will of God through reading the Bible.
4. Take into account providential circumstances.
5. I ask God in prayer to reveal His will to me.
6. Through prayer to God [perfect prayer and with understanding] and study of the Word, I come
to deliberate judgement according to the best of my ability and knowledge, and if mind is at
peace, and continues after two or three more petitions, I proceed accordingly.
Expect great things from God and great things you will have. There is no limit what He is able to
do. Praise Him and thank Him for everything!

The geographic divisions and history of Palestine - Walter Cummins

First of all, I should say the word Palestine essentially comes from the idea of the Philistines that inhabited this area. The Philistines were the enemies of Israel during the Judges period, part of that time. David fought against the Philistines.
Remember Goliath? He was a Philistine. And Palestine is that area that belonged to the Philistines. And so it's the whole country.
And then the country is divided up into different divisions. And of course, at different times in history, it had different divisions. And we're concerned with the New Testament times, but before you get there, you have to study the Old Testament times.
